Skip to content

Make loading settings robust to subscripted generics. #662

Make loading settings robust to subscripted generics.

Make loading settings robust to subscripted generics. #662

Triggered via pull request February 27, 2026 23:43
Status Success
Total duration 1m 38s
Artifacts 5

test.yml

on: pull_request
Matrix: test
base_coverage
56s
base_coverage
Matrix: test-with-unpinned-deps
coverage
6s
coverage
Fit to window
Zoom out
Zoom in

Annotations

10 warnings
coverage: src/labthings_fastapi/thing.py#L313
313-315 lines are not covered with tests
coverage: src/labthings_fastapi/thing.py#L261
261 line is not covered with tests
coverage: src/labthings_fastapi/thing.py#L241
241 line is not covered with tests
coverage: src/labthings_fastapi/thing.py#L224
224 line is not covered with tests
coverage: src/labthings_fastapi/properties.py#L1047
1047 line is not covered with tests
coverage: src/labthings_fastapi/properties.py#L820
820 line is not covered with tests
coverage: src/labthings_fastapi/properties.py#L801
801 line is not covered with tests
coverage: src/labthings_fastapi/properties.py#L726
726-729 lines are not covered with tests
coverage: src/labthings_fastapi/properties.py#L703
703 line is not covered with tests
coverage: src/labthings_fastapi/properties.py#L699
699 line is not covered with tests

Artifacts

Produced during runtime
Name Size Digest
base-coverage.lcov
11.7 KB
sha256:7df4d945249e0cd98914970a6f3dd88a849d6d70ab4daaea7a5a672bad4cc228
coverage-3.10
11.8 KB
sha256:b5f792b29acab4f60826823c258d44f5992e19464adfba766897205305e4749a
coverage-3.11
11.8 KB
sha256:5232238c9d7be2fbd59f253a81e7270e7bec57623da64e4399780574c9a79550
coverage-3.12
11.8 KB
sha256:9d0e0b14c31013b5864aab0f9ae74e6392fbe725922db1b6bb7c8d50ec5183a4
coverage-3.13
11.8 KB
sha256:7310c298879dc8c549575f6d64aec0a16bdfe2b22e09efc26e3b8243a93d6d74